Common House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ation Crack Repair - addresses and seals cracks to prevent further damage and water intrusion.
Concrete Pier and Beam Support - stabilizes and lifts settling or uneven foundation sections.
Slab Stabilization - reinforces and level concrete slabs to restore structural integrity.
Foundation Underpinning - strengthens and raises sinking foundations for improved stability.
Basement Wall Reinforcement - repairs bowing or cracked basement walls to prevent collapse.
Drainage and Waterproofing - manages water flow to protect foundations from moisture-related issues.
House Foundation Repair Questions
What are common signs of foundation problems? Indicators include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ation.
What causes foundation damage? Factors such as soil movement, moisture changes, poor construction, and tree roots can lead to foundation issues.
What types of foundation repair are available? Repairs may involve underpinning, wall stabilization, slab jacking, or crack sealing, depending on the problem.
Why is early repair important? Addressing foundation issues early helps prevent further damage, structural instability, and costly repairs later on.
